Mohammed "Mo" Abad, a 43-year-old security guard from Scotland who spent most of his life without sex organs, has been fitted with an 8-inch "bionic" penis he hopes will help him to finally lose his virginity.

When Abad was only 6 years old, he sustained traumatic injuries to his thighs and lost his genitals after being struck by a car and dragged for more than 600 yards. But according to a recent report by British newspaper The Sun, Abad’s life is about to change thanks to his new inflatable penis.

The penis is allegedly able to accurately mimic the function of a real penis and may even allow Abad to partake in sexual intercourse. The robotic penis contains two tubes that fill up with fluid stored in the stomach in order to mirror an erection when activated by a button in the testicles. The penis is also lined with flesh grafted from his arm to give it a more realistic look and feel, The Daily Mail reported.

“When you want a bit of action, you press the ‘on’ button. When you are finished, you press another button. It takes seconds. Doctors have told me to keep practicing,” Abad told The Sun.

The artificial penis was fitted on Abad by surgeons at University College London and took around three years to both mold and fit the custom-made prosthesis. Although Abad has been previously married and is now divorced, he still considers himself to be a virgin and told The Sun that he is eager to use his new appendage and find women who “might want to try it out.”
